I've been a casual lurker since I got my first mech last September. Since then I've gone through a few different boards trying to find my perfect layout and switch.. but I'm still not there yet. So far this is what I've tried:
  • Quickfire TK w/Cherry Browns
  • Ducky Shine 5 w/Cherry Browns
  • MK Disco w/KBT Browns
  • Magicforce 68 w/Outemu Blues
  • Ergodox w/ Cherry Blues
  • Tada68 w/Gateron Blacks
I still have the last 4 boards (in the process of unloading the Ergodox and Disco.) I've found the Magicforce to be perfect for work. I want to get a new one in black with possibly different switches (this was a $40 board that I just got to try out the layout.) I'm just not sure what switches I want. I love the feel of typing on these blues, but they're a little loud for my liking. I don't mind it all the time, in fact sometimes I like it, but something a little quieter would be nice.

I've found I don't really notice the tactile bump with browns and I've read that clears may be better, but I'm honestly a little worried about busting a switch when I swap keycaps. I did that with my Quickfire TK the very first time I took the caps off so it's always in the back of my mind now.

Typing on the Gateron blacks is actually pretty pleasant, but I find myself missing the tactile feedback I get with my Magicforce. Sometimes I swap in my work board just for a more satisfying feel when the wife isn't around so the noise doesn't bug her.

Having said all that -- I'm not sure what switch I want to try out next. I have a couple switch testers but I've found they don't accurately portray what it's like to actively use that switch. Only time on the board will really do that. Part of me wants to try Topre, just because, but again I'm not sure what to start with.
